FACTS_PEDIAX_OFFICIAL © on Instagram: "The science behind why the Pacific and Atlantic Oceans sometimes appear not to mix. Although it may look like a clear boundary exists between the two, there is no permanent separation. The apparent separation occurs due to differences in salinity, temperature, and density.
